Recently, Ebonite
International, Inc. stopped selling its house balls through
distributors. Instead, Ebonite now reaches bowling centers on a
direct basis, through it’s Bowling Center Direct program. Indiana is
now one of the programs newest members.
Bowling Center Direct allows
Ebonite to deliver its house balls to bowling centers on a more
economical and efficient basis. However, Ebonite would like to go
further than just selling house balls at good prices. It is now a
promotional vehicle for all member state’s proprietor’s as well.
Here is how it works. For every
Ebonite Super Solar House Ball purchased, at a special price, by an
Indiana Bowling Centers Association member, Ebonite will contribute
$1.00 per ball to the IBCA marketing fund.
For IBCA members, regular house
balls will be sold for only $29.00. Drilled and engraved balls, can
be purchased by members for only $31.50.
Ebonite has also added rental
shoes to this program. These vinyl shoes with padded arches, vented
uppers and rubber soles are also bacteria resistant, to prevent
odor. These shoes come with a $0.50 per pair rebate and are only
$16.95 for up to 47 pairs.
For youth leagues, Ebonite is
also providing special pricing to Indiana proprietors on all of its
Garfield and Odie products. Many of these products will also have
contributions made to the IBCA marketing fund when purchased.
To get started, the bowling
center orders a Garfield Have-A-Ball Promotion Kit, which arrives
fully stocked with everything needed to promote the event, including
balls, bags, towels, sign up sheet and more. The kit price of
$199.95 includes shipping and handling.
Garfield and Odie balls are
priced at $30.50 and Garfield bags are only $8.50. The IBCA
marketing fund will receive $1.00 per bag and $0.50 per bag sold.
